High-Wealth Individuals' Role in CSR:

High-net-worth individuals have significant financial resources, influence, and connections that can be used to address societal issues. These individuals can assist advance sustainable development goals and foster long-term prosperity by incorporating social and environmental factors into their investing strategies, philanthropy initiatives, and personal lifestyles.

The Importance of CSR Certification:

While many wealthy individuals have embraced CSR projects, there is an increasing demand for a standardised framework to ensure their commitment and accountability. CSR certification provides formal validation of their efforts, giving their actions legitimacy and transparency. It aids in distinguishing genuine devotion from insincere gestures, allowing stakeholders to make educated decisions while dealing with wealthy persons. 

Furthermore, certification promotes a culture of sustainability and social consciousness among this key group by instilling a sense of duty and encouraging ongoing improvement.

The Advantages of CSR Certification for High-Net-Worth Individuals:

Increased Credibility: CSR certification confers a respected seal of approval on high-net-worth individuals, proving their dedication to sustainable practises and incorporating corporate social responsibility. This credibility increases their brand and positions them as responsible global citizens. Increased Stakeholder Engagement: Certification increases confidence among stakeholders such as investors, partners, and communities. High-net-worth individuals can attract like-minded colleagues and develop mutually beneficial connections based on shared ideals by clearly displaying their CSR efforts. Risk Mitigation: CSR certification assists high-net-worth individuals in mitigating the risks of reputational damage and social reaction. They demonstrate their proactive commitment to tackling environmental, social, and governance (ESG) concerns by adhering to recognised standards and best practises. Networking and Collaboration Opportunities: Certification programmes enable high-net-worth individuals to engage with other certified individuals, organisations, and CSR professionals. This networking enables knowledge sharing, joint projects, and the exchange of innovative ideas, so increasing the impact of their combined efforts.
